Tech stack
Testing (Software)
Java
Automation of Tests
Cloud Computing
Relational Databases
Payment Systems
Java Platform Enterprise Edition (J2EE)
Human-Computer Interaction
Java Persistence API
JUnit
Object-Oriented Software Development
Scrum
Selenium
SQL Databases
React
GIT
Kubernetes
Cucumber
Job description
- Full-timeEmployment type: Full-time
- €54,500 - €69,000 (XING estimate)
- On-site
- Be an early applicant
Requirements
Der ideale Kandidat bringt mehrjährige Berufserfahrung im Softwaretesting mit, insbesondere mit JUnit-Tests unter Verwendung von Mock-Technologien wie JMockit, sowie in der Testautomatisierung mit Cucumber und Selenium. Kenntnisse in der Sourcecode-Verwaltung mittels GIT sind ebenfalls erforderlich. Zudem sollten Sie über ein gutes Know-how in relationalen Datenbanken (SQL, JPA) und in der objektorientierten Programmierung mit Java (ab Version 8) verfügen. Kenntnisse in JEE und in der Implementierung von grafischen Benutzeroberflächen, beispielsweise mit JSF2 oder React, sind von Vorteil. Erfahrungen in Cloud-, Container- und Kubernetes-Umgebungen sowie Methodenkompetenz im agilen Arbeiten (Scrum) sind wünschenswert. Ein hohes Qualitäts- und Sicherheitsbewusstsein sowie eine selbständige und analytische Arbeitsweise runden Ihr Profil ab. Fließende Deutschkenntnisse sind erforderlich.
Technologien
Java React Kubernetes Git
Soft Skills
Teamfähigkeit Analytisches Denken Selbstständigkeit
Erforderliche Sprachen
Deutsch
Benefits & conditions
Vor Ort
Vollzeit
Mid-Level
vor 22 Tagen
70.000 € - 85.000 € / Jahr
About the company
Möchten Sie das Bezahlen der Zukunft mitgestalten und verändern? Dann werden Sie Teil des Teams bei unserem Kunden! Dieser Arbeitgeber ist der Taktgeber für alle Payment-Themen in der Finanzgruppe. Mit einem direkten Einfluss auf über 45 Millionen Endkund:innen entwickelt und vermarktet das Unternehmen innovative Payment-Lösungen sowohl für den Point of Sale als auch für E- und M-Commerce. Dazu gehören unter anderem das kontaktlose Bezahlen mit Karten und Smartphones sowie viele weitere Lösungen. In Ihrer Rolle als Softwareentwickler im Testing sind Sie verantwortlich für die Konzeption und Entwicklung von automatisierten Softwaretests mit Cucumber und die Programmierung zur Erweiterung der Automatisierungslösungen in Java. Sie übernehmen Verantwortung, indem Sie Integrations-, Regressions- und Modultests mit modernen Technologien für ein System mit hohen Sicherheitsanforderungen entwickeln. Gemeinsam mit den Fachexpert:innen leiten Sie die Testfälle und Testdaten aus den Anforderungen und
Fachkonzepten ab. Zudem führen Sie die jeweiligen Tests aus und erarbeiten die Testdokumentationen entsprechend der Qualitätsstandards in JIRA. Das Arbeitsumfeld ist geprägt von einem hohen Qualitäts- und Sicherheitsbewusstsein, einer selbständigen sowie analytischen Arbeitsweise und einem starken Fokus auf Teamarbeit und Innovation.